Surface First

ATP predictions change by surface. Clay rewards rally tolerance, movement, and point construction. Grass rewards serve, slice, and first-strike pressure. Hard courts vary by speed and conditions. Indoor courts can make serve rhythm more valuable.

A player’s ranking is only part of the read. The surface decides whether his strengths show up today.

Serve And Return

Men’s tennis can be highly serve-driven, but return quality still decides spreads, totals, and upset chances. A strong server may keep a match close even as an underdog. A strong returner can make a favorite more reliable by creating break chances in multiple sets.

Use serve and return matchup before choosing moneyline, game spread, total games, set betting, or props.

Format Matters

ATP matches can be best-of-three or best-of-five depending on the event. Best-of-five gives stronger players more time to solve the match but can also expose fitness problems. Best-of-three creates more volatility and makes first-set performance more important.

The prediction needs to fit the format. A favorite who starts slowly can be safer in best-of-five than best-of-three.

Rest And Travel

Today’s ATP slate can include players coming from long matches, quick turnarounds, different continents, or late-night finishes. Rest does not decide every match, but it can change confidence when the matchup is physical.

Travel and fatigue are most useful when they connect to style. A long-rally clay match after a marathon can be very different from a quick indoor serve matchup.

Tournament Level

ATP predictions today need tournament context. A Grand Slam, Masters, 500, 250, qualifier, and Challenger-level match do not carry the same pressure, field strength, or pricing depth. A player may be dominant at one level and ordinary when the opponent quality rises.

Tournament level also affects motivation and schedule. A top player managing workload may approach an early round differently than a player fighting for ranking points.

Favorites And Underdogs

ATP favorites can be expensive because the market trusts serve and ranking. Underdogs can be live when they hold serve well, attack second serves, or fit the surface better than the favorite. Neither side is automatic. The price has to match the path.

A favorite with poor return pressure may be safer on moneyline than spread. An underdog with strong serve but weak return may be better for total games than a full upset.
